Chiefs and Americans Grab Monday Wins
The Andre Chiefs overcame a 3-0 first inning deficit to eventually walk off with a 7-6 win over TJO Sports on Monday at Maplewood. Michael McCarthy and Nate Witkowski each had two hits and drove in two runs apiece for the Chiefs. Carlo Rosa’s hit in the bottom of the seventh provided the game winner. Dominic Monico went the first 5.2 innings, striking out 10, before giving way to Vance Serano (3-2) who recorded the win…..The first place Melrose Americans held off a six run seventh inning rally to beat the Boston A’s 14-13 at Morelli Field. Ryan Bourgeois led the offense with two hits that included a homer and three RBI while Pat Costigan added three singles and drove in a couple of runs. Bailey Taylor Black (2-0) threw three innings to get the win….The E.I. Braves scored nine times in the top of the third inning and went on to beat the Blue Sox 11-6 in Lexington…….
